The DS18 LRING6 is a 6.5-inch waterproof RGB LED speaker ring designed to enhance your audio system with millions of color options and dynamic lighting effects. Engineered for marine-grade durability, it withstands water and mud while offering easy installation with pre-drilled holes and an acrylic spacer. Compatible with wireless controllers, it integrates seamlessly into any setup, making your speakers not just heard but seen.
